FAQ’S

Can children skate?

We welcome children to skate on any day up until 10pm, when we become an adult only venue due to licensing conditions.

How do your sessions work and What is last entry?

We want to provide an immersive experience, therefore allowing skaters to ‘stay on’ for further sessions should they wish to enjoy all of the delights here at Roller Jam, therefore, you can arrive any time during the session times that you have purchased tickets for. We don’t have a last entry on any of our sessions.

Do I need Identification?

We have a challenge 25 policy in place, so it’s an advisory to save disappointment

Skate Hire. Do I have to pre-book? How much? Are only quads available? Can you bring your own? What Sizes? Protective gear?

We hire skates from £2.50 . We advise skaters to pre-book where possible to avoid disappointment during busier sessions. We have various sizes ranging from a junior size 11 to an adult size 13. We also supply wrist guards as part of our £2.50 inclusive price. We have some inline skates available for those that prefer them. Please ask our skate crew on arrival if this is your preference. We welcome customers to bring their own skates for a more enjoyable experience. We allow both quads and inline skates.

Can I pay on the door? How long do you generally get?

You can pay on the door, but booking as advised for our weekend sessions and also special events.

Do you have lockers or somewhere safe for my possessions?

Yes! We have a monitored cloakroom available for £2 per person.

Can I park nearby?

Roller Jam is located within the Drive in a green zone restrictions. There is plenty of parking on Glover Street, directly outside our venue

Private Parties? Discount for group bookings?

We can arrange larger parties, and a discount is available upon request for any large group bookings or private hire. Contact us: events@rollerjam.co.uk

I cant make my skate session. Can I swap my day?

Please contact our official ticket selling partner Skiddle for any ticket exchange

I don’t want to skate, can I still come along?

Yes of course. We have a spectator ticket option on all events, priced at just £5. This can also be paid on the door
